How to Choose the Right Electroplated Core Bit Supplier in Kenya

With so many suppliers to choose from, picking the right one depends on your specific needs. Here are a few key factors to consider:

  • Project Type: For hard rock mining, prioritize suppliers like Kenyan Mining & Drilling Technologies with advanced bit technology. For shallow water wells, Northern Drilling Essentials or Nairobi Core Bit Wholesalers may offer better value.
  • Location: If you’re in Western Kenya, Western Kenya Drilling Supplies can save on shipping time. For coastal projects, Coastal Drilling Solutions understands saltwater corrosion challenges.
  • Budget: Nairobi Core Bit Wholesalers and Northern Drilling Essentials are great for cost-sensitive buyers, while Eco-Drill Kenya and KMDT cater to those willing to invest in premium features.
  • Sustainability Goals: Eco-Drill Kenya is the clear choice if reducing environmental impact is a priority.

No matter which supplier you choose, always ask for product specifications and, if possible, test a sample bit before placing a large order. The right electroplated core bit can significantly boost your drilling efficiency—so take the time to find a supplier that aligns with your project goals.
